MotionX-GPS Adds New Features for Skiing and Snowboarding
Calendar16 Mon, 09 Jan 2012 23:45:00 UTC +00:00
Newsdate: January 9, 2012 3:45 pm   Posted in Navigation, Sports    Fullpower-MotionX today announced a major update to its MotionX-GPS App for iPhone and iPod touch that adds support for skiing and snowboarding. MotionX-GPS is now the perfect app to take to the slopes as it’s been enhanced with a new ski/snowboard mode to make your mountain experience even more fun. New features let you know exactly where your friends and family are on the mountain via live position updates. This makes it easier for meeting up on the slopes and tracking each other. MotionX-GPS is also handy for tracking your vertical position and maximum speed.  “The MotionX-GPS App is my constant skiing companion,” said Eva Twardokens, MotionX spokesperson, Olympian and U.S. Ski and Snowboard Hall of Fame inductee. “I use MotionX-GPS on my iPhone to track my skiing speed and to share my location and photos with friends and family. MotionX GPS Drive HD Now Available For iPad 3G
Calendar16 Fri, 11 Jun 2010 19:51:26 UTC +00:00
MotionX has jumped on the iPad 3G navigation bandwagon with MotionX GPS Drive HD. MotionX GPS Drive HD maintains the same great feature set of the iPhone focused but gets a revamped UI to make the best use of the iPad’s larger display. What makes MotionX GPS Drive stand out from other iPad 3G GPS navigation solutions? MotionX takes pride in delivering the most up-to-date information at your fingertips. Their products continuously grab the latest NAVTEQ map data, Bing search results, and TrafficCast live predictive traffic data. What about when your iPad loses its Internet connection? MotionX GPS Drive HD allows up to 2GB of route and map data caching. MotionX GPS Drive HD has plenty of other common features like live weather, live traffic, automatic night and day modes, iPod music control, route simulation, points-of-interest search, and voice guidance. If you're not sure about this whole iPhone turn-by-turn thing, and you've been too afraid to try it because the apps are so expensive, hey, look: Motionx Drive, our favorite budget iPhone nav app, is just a dollar right now. Granted, this should be seen as a trial, because it only includes a month of full services, after which a navigation subscription costs $3 a month or $25 a year via in-app purchases, though the months don't have to be consecutive, so you can sort of just pay as you go, buying nav access only when you need it. If you're driving anywhere over the holidays, seriously, just give it a shot. Four quarters, folks! Read More

What an iPhone GPS app should be
sjonke 5.0 stars Version: 1.1
This is the GPS app that you'll want to show off... and use. Based on Bing maps and data (points of interest), what you get is what you should get on the iPhone - continually updated maps and POI, plus the POI covers everything, not just a selection of popular coffee shops and such - you can search for and find anything, then navigate to it. It caches your route to cover blind spots, although if you have no data connection you can't make a new route, and that is an issue. Nonetheless, this is the one you'll want to use day-to-day because it is live data-based. It does need text-to-speech and lane assist, but hopefully they'll come in updates and it works great as-is. GPS signal has not been an issue for me so far, but it should work with the TomTom mount/receiver if need be. I'm sticking with my Kensington dash/windshield mount for now at least. It's loaded with nice features including iPod controls that even let you make a playlist. It's a must-buy for every iPhone user and it's cheap - $24.99 for a year of voice navigation 3D map service or $2.99 for 30 days if you want to only pay when needed (30 days are included in the app price).
